Type
ORACLE
Validation date
2025-08-15 06:24: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 1.715e-4,
    "usd": 2.001e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001A4F8B9DD673749DE1BEFF81156D11EB8513EA2442DBC99A8A183C03EB84B65DF

Previous signature

36882002C354B7E065C1BA8B13A2CF4DB3FEBFFBCB9C9634CFCE3CFBB7AF784271398E636914F62370428844332B813C4ED74B482BEA9E8186BAA131D995C204

Origin signature

304502201CF83361E720F7482D918F61425E89BF86B1CEF4FFB2E2ED22D07EB28C80D92B0221008E3A347FC52D96F054A5623CA3BE149BFB6651EF22F967656980B6136E476B36

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

00C4C9E54C2B3EC2159E24E5134C492E18B0B7DCE73C4EEFCF8DAD2E4FF3F3C2DC

Coordinator signature

A39C529597BA83077287E576C5B624FF684E8F5949E2DCB940853523810BC8A51B1CFBF7341F5663ED4FF770E99112ACD39C8859D1D79E7BC636EE22C6DB0D02

Validator #1 public key

00018A13A9C85FE66CE097EE273C6F1E612289BFB0B630C34AF60957E8DE880633E2

Validator #1 signature

90DA761824A4C3A170105B90AE0DB11BA431C002CBEB583D08CD42AA423729F42391F34A61259CFEC35004E12F920030CB1E52B5B7AE52EC1FACB31B19A9E807

Validator #2 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#2 signature

7874ED2467FBFF5FF1E18C9E39399BDC9D1A1135EA4E69A696523765E12E27A244FE4E4476D1816924943623B199F00A91C7F2E0389DFB03876F5993B4FABD08